Second Life - 1st IP Case?
Further to my recent post, on Friday 6 July, Warwick Rothnie's excellent blog (IP War's) reported a copyright suit brought by a Second Life Resident (Mr Alderman) in relation to products sold by him in Second Life. The Reuters report included the results of an in-game interview with the alleged infringer - Volkov Catteneo in which he confidently stated that he would be hard to track down - not having a permanent address, even in real life. Linden Labs, who runs Second Life, will be embroiled via subpoena from Mr Alderman's attorneys. 'Reality' really is stranger than fiction.
